Baseball Recap: McDonogh 35 Roneagles vs. Landry Buccaneers

Suggested Video

While McDonogh 35 put up plenty of runs on Thursday, the same can't be said for Landry. The Roneagles put the hurt on the Buccaneers with a sharp 20-0 win. That looming 20-0 mark stands out as the most commanding margin for the Roneagles yet this season.

Naamon Landry was a major factor no matter where he played. He pitched one inning while giving up no earned runs or hits. He has been nothing but reliable on the mound: he hasn't given up more than one hit in five consecutive appearances. He was even better at the plate, scoring two runs and stealing three bases while going 2-for-2.

In other batting news, Jakam Glinn and Steven Wade did most of the damage at the plate: Glinn scored a run and stole three bases while going 2-for-2, while Wade scored two runs and stole four bases while going 1-for-1. Glinn has been hot, having posted two or more stolen bases the last seven times he's played. Kentrell Allen was another key player, scoring a run and stealing a base while going 1-for-1.

McDonogh 35 always had someone on base and finished the game having posted an OBP of .846. That's the best OBP they've posted all season.

McDonogh 35 has been performing incredibly well recently as they've won eight of their last nine contests. That's provided a nice bump to their 12-4 record this season. The team dominated over that stretch too, winning by an average of 11.8 runs. As for Landry, they dropped their record down to 0-6 with the loss, which was their eighth straight at home dating back to last season.

Both teams will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. McDonogh 35 will head out to square off against New Orleans Military & Maritime Academy at 4:00 p.m. on Monday. As for Landry, they will venture away from home to take on South Plaquemines at 4:30 p.m. on Monday.
